ACTUARIAL ANALYST / SENIOR ACTUARIAL ANALYST – CORPORATE ACTUARIAL
We are a fast-growing commercial property and casualty insurance company with operations in Canada and the United States. Our business focuses on commercial lines with a smaller personal lines portfolio. Some of our key products include liability, property, surety, and warranty. This is an exciting opportunity to join the small and growing corporate actuarial department.
This role supports the Head of Corporate Actuarial and plays a key part in reserving and financial reporting activities. The successful candidate will have the opportunity to contribute to critical financial processes while working on diverse lines of business.
Accountabilities Include:
- Conduct reserving analyses across multiple lines of business
- Assist with quarterly and annual financial reporting
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ams (underwriting, finance, claims, actuarial pricing) to provide insights into business performance and trends
- Support the Financial Condition Testing (FCT) and Own Risk and Solvency Assessment Processes
- Support Finance in the maintenance of the financial forecast models
- Develop and maintain actuarial models to enhance reserving processes
- Identify and implement process improvements and best practices within the corporate actuarial function
- Assist in performing other pricing, reserving, data analytics, or predictive modeling analyses as needed
Qualifications:
- Actively working towards an ACAS or FCAS designation
- 2 to 7+ years of relevant work experience
- Experience in property and casualty reserving is an asset
- Experience with Arius reserving software is an asset
- Experience in financial reporting, including IFRS17, is an asset
